    A population-based examination of cancer in New South Wales farm residents compared to rural non-farm and urban residents

    The cancer indicators and outcomes of rural Australians are generally less favourable than those of their urban counterparts, but the situation for farm residents is less well known. With a focus on farm residents, this study aimed to identify differences between farm, rural non-farm and urban residents in a large NSW cohort, in: (1) incidence and mortality from major cancers; (2) screening rates, stage at diagnosis and selected cancer therapies; and (3) common risk factors associated with these cancers. Cancers of interest were breast, cervical, colorectal, lung and prostate cancers; melanoma and Non Hodgkins Lymphoma. The Sax Institute’s 45 and Up Study was used to define resident groups and to compare baseline cancer-related risk factors. Cancer mortality, incidence, stage at diagnoses, cancer screening practices and selected cancer treatments were compared through data linkage with routine state and national health datasets. Direct age-standardisation, proportional hazards regression and logistic regression were used to compare cancer indicators, controlling for common risk factors. Overall, farm residents had lower all cancer incidence and mortality risk than rural non-farm or urban counterparts, but differences were only significant for all cancer incidence in farm women compared to rural non-farm women. For specific cancers, breast cancer mortality risk was also significantly lower in farm women than rural non-farm women, but incidence and mortality risk for other cancers were not significantly different. However, whilst confidence intervals did not exclude unity, adjusted point estimates for incidence or mortality risk suggest that compared to other groups, farm residents had a similar or reduced risk of breast, colorectal and lung cancer; similar risk of NHL; and farm men similar or slightly raised risk of melanoma and prostate cancer. There were no significant differences in stage at diagnosis for prostate, breast and colorectal cancers. Small case numbers in the farm group were likely to have contributed to lack of significance of findings for some analyses. Screening practices of farm and rural non-farm residents were generally similar; but both rural groups had significantly less frequent PSA tests, Pap tests, mammograms and colonoscopies than urban residents. Cancer-related surgical services for breast and colorectal cancer were comparable between all groups. Some findings for non-surgical therapies should be considered with caution, but both farm and rural non-farm residents were significantly less likely to access chemotherapy for breast cancer and brachytherapy for prostate cancer than urban counterparts. Strengths and limitations of the research are discussed. Pending confirmation of findings in other studies, results have implications for cancer screening and treatment services in rural Australia. The reasons why farm residents may have lower incidence and / or mortality risk for some cancers should also be considered for further research

    Beyond 50. challenges at work for older nurses and allied health workers in rural Australia: a thematic analysis of focus group discussions

    <p>Abstract</p> <p>Background</p> <p>The health workforce in Australia is ageing, particularly in rural areas, where this change will have the most immediate implications for health care delivery and workforce needs. In rural areas, the sustainability of health services will be dependent upon nurses and allied health workers being willing to work beyond middle age, yet the particular challenges for older health workers in rural Australia are not well known. The purpose of this research was to identify aspects of work that have become more difficult for rural health workers as they have become older; and the age-related changes and exacerbating factors that contribute to these difficulties. Findings will support efforts to make workplaces more 'user-friendly' for older health workers.</p> <p>Methods</p> <p>Nurses and allied health workers aged 50 years and over were invited to attend one of six local workshops held in the Hunter New England region of NSW, Australia. This qualitative action research project used a focus group methodology and thematic content analysis to identify and interpret issues arising from workshop discussions.</p> <p>Results</p> <p>Eighty older health workers from a range of disciplines attended the workshops. Tasks and aspects of work that have become more difficult for older health workers in hospital settings, include reading labels and administering medications; hearing patients and colleagues; manual handling; particular movements and postures; shift work; delivery of babies; patient exercises and suturing. In community settings, difficulties relate to vehicle use and home visiting. Significant issues across settings include ongoing education, work with computers and general fatigue. Wider personal challenges include coping with change, balancing work-life commitments, dealing with attachments and meeting goals and expectations. Work and age-related factors that exacerbate difficulties include vision and hearing deficits, increasing tiredness, more complex professional roles and a sense of not being valued in the context of greater perceived workload.</p> <p>Conclusions</p> <p>Older health workers are managing a range of issues, on top of the general challenges of rural practice. Personal health, wellbeing and other realms of life appear to take on increasing importance for older health workers when faced with increasing difficulties at work. Solutions need to address difficulties at personal, workplace and system wide levels.</p

    The Significance of an Increased Beta-Hydroxybutyrate at Presentation to the Emergency Department in Patients with Diabetes in the Absence of a Hyperglycemic Emergency

The significance of hyperketonemia in adults with diabetes presenting to the emergency department with acute illness, not due to a diabetic hyperglycemic emergency, has not been well characterized. Adult patients with diabetes presenting to the emergency department who had venous blood gas and beta-hydroxybutyrate levels measured whilst in the emergency department were retrospectively evaluated for the relationship between BHB and clinical outcomes. Over 6 months, 404 patients with diabetes had at least one beta-hydroxybutyrate level measured in the emergency department. There were 23 admissions for diabetic ketoacidosis (DKA) or hyperosmolar state. Of the remainder, 58 patients had a beta-hydroxybutyrate≥1 mmol/L; this group had a higher glucose at presentation (19.0 (8.8) versus 10.4 (9.9) mmol/L), higher HbA1c (8.8 (5.4) versus 8.0 (3.3)%), lower bicarbonate (22.6 (6.2) versus 24.8 (4.7) mmol/L), and higher anion gap (14.8 (6.1) versus 12.6 (4.2)) than had those with BHB<1 mmol/L. There was no association between the presence of ketosis and the length of stay (4.2 (7.3) versus (3.0) (7.2) days). Acute illness in those with diabetes associated with ketosis in the absence of DKA is associated with worse glycaemic control than in those without ketosis. Ketosis may represent an intermediate state of metabolic dysregulation rather than being associated with a more severe acute illness, as suggested by no relationship between BHB and length of stay

    Farm noise emissions during common agricultural activities

    Noise injury in agriculture is a significant yet often unrecognized problem. Many farmers, farm workers, and family members are exposed to noise levels above recommended levels and have greater hearing loss than their non-farming contemporaries. The aim of this study was to gather up-to-date information on farm noise levels and to enhance the quality of information available to assist farmers in reducing noise exposure and meeting Occupational Health and Safety (OHS) regulations regarding noise management. Farm visits were conducted on 48 agricultural establishments that produce a range of commodities. Noise levels were measured at the ears of operators and bystanders involved in typical activities on farms. The average and peak noise levels were measured for 56 types of machinery or sites of farming activity, totaling 298 separate items and activities. Common noise hazards identified included firearms, tractors without cabs, workshop tools, small motors (e.g., chainsaws, augers, pumps), manual handling of pigs, shearing sheds, older cabbed tractors, and heavy machinery such as harvesters, bulldozers, and cotton module presses. We found that use of firearms without hearing protection presents a pressing hearing health priority. However, farming activities involving machinery used for prolonged periods also present significant risks to farmers’ hearing health. Noise management strategies on the farm are essential in order to prevent noise injury among farmers

    Hearing screening program impact on noise reduction strategies

    The objective of this study was to determine the impact of the New South Wales Rural Hearing Conservation Program on the implementation of personal hearing protection (PHP) and noise management strategies among farmers who had participated in this program in New South Wales, Australia. A follow-up survey of a random sample of people screened through the New South Wales Rural Hearing Conservation Program was linked to their baseline data. The use of PHP at baseline was compared to use at follow-up in four specific scenarios: use with non-cabbed tractors, with chainsaws, with firearms, and in workshops. For non-cabbed tractors, the net gain in PHP use was 13.3%; the net gain was 20.8% for chainsaws, 6.7% for firearms, and 21.3% for workshops. Older farmers and those with a family history of hearing loss were less likely to maintain or improve PHP use. Those with severe hearing loss, males, and participants reporting hearing problems in situations where background noise was present were more likely to maintain or improve PHP use. Forty-one percent of farmers had initiated other strategies to reduce noise exposure beyond the use of PHP, which included engineering, maintenance, and noise avoidance solutions. The early (hopefully) identification of hearing deficit in farmers and farm workers can help promote behavior change and help reinforce a farm culture that supports hearing conservation. The continuation and expansion of hearing screening programs such as these should be encouraged as basic public health strategy in farming communities

    Macroalgae removal on coral reefs: realised ecosystem functions transcend biogeographic locations

    Coral reef ecosystems are at the forefront of biodiversity loss and climate change-mediated transformations. This is expected to have profound consequences for the functioning of these ecosystems. However, assessments of ecosystem function on reefs are often spatially limited, within biogeographic realms, or rely on presumed proxies such as traits. To address these shortcomings and assess the effects of biogeography and fish presence on the critical ecosystem function of macroalgal removal, we used assays of six algal genera across three reef habitats in two biogeographically distinct locations: Little Cayman in the Caribbean and Lizard Island on the Great Barrier Reef (GBR). Patterns of fish feeding and realised ecosystem function were strikingly similar between the two geographic locations, despite a threefold difference in the local diversity of nominally herbivorous fishes, a 2.4-fold difference in the diversity of fishes feeding and differences in the biogeographic history of the two locations. In both regions, a single species dominated the function: a surgeonfish, Naso unicornis, at the GBR location and, surprisingly, a triggerfish, Melichthys niger, at the Caribbean location. Both species, especially M. niger, were relatively rare, compared to other nominally herbivorous fishes, in censuses covering more than 14,000 m(2) at each location. Our study provides novel insights into the critical function of macroalgal removal in hyperdiverse coral reef ecosystems, highlighting: (a) that function can transcend biogeographic, taxonomic and historical constraints; and (b) shortcomings in our assumptions regarding fish presence and realised ecosystem function on coral reefs

    Management strategies to minimize the dredging impacts of coastal development on fish and fisheries

    Accelerating coastal development and shipping activities dictate that dredging operations will intensify, increasing potential impacts to fishes. Coastal fishes have high economic, ecological, and conservation significance and there is a need for evidencebased, quantitative guidelines on how to mitigate the impacts of dredging activities. We assess the potential risk from dredging to coastal fish and fisheries on a global scale.We then develop quantitative guidelines for two management strategies: threshold reference values and seasonal restrictions. Globally, threatened species and nearshore fisheries occur within close proximity to ports. We find that maintaining suspended sediment concentrations below 44 mg/L (15–121 bootstrapped CI) and for less than 24 hours would protect 95% of fishes from dredging-induced mortality. Implementation of seasonal restrictions during peak periods of reproduction and recruitment could further protect species from dredging impacts. This study details the first evidence-based defensible approach to minimize impacts to coastal fishes from dredging activities

    External tagging does not affect the feeding behavior of a coral reef fish, Chaetodon vagabundus (Pisces: Chaetodontidae)

Although a variety of methods exist, external tags remain one of the most widely applied because they are both effective and cost efficient. However, a key assumption is that neither the tagging procedure nor the presence of a tag negatively affects the individual. While this has been demonstrated for relatively coarse metrics such as growth and survival, few studies have examined the impact of tags and tagging on more subtle aspects of behavior. We tagged adult vagabond butterflyfish (Chaetodon vagabundus) occupying a 30-ha insular reef in Kimbe Bay, Papua New Guinea, using a commonly-utilized t-bar anchor tag. We quantified and compared feeding behavior (bite rate), which is sensitive to stress, of tagged and untagged individuals over four separate sampling periods spanning four months post-tagging.
